About The Position

The Case Review Specialist position serves as a Case Reviewer for the program. This position will facilitate case plan development meetings and semi-annual (SAR) case plan reviews with families, service teams, foster parents, counselors, and other service providers.

Responsibilities

  • Perform all work in a manner consistent with the National Youth Advocate Program’s mission, values, and philosophies.
  • Coordinates schedules and completes case reviews, including but not limited to, initial Case Plan Family Team meetings, quarterly Family Team meetings, SAR case reviews.
  • Completes required documentation in a timely manner.
  • Collects and compiles data for reporting purposes.
  • Acts as an independent Case Reviewer to assure that all current service needs are being addressed appropriately.
  • Prepares for reviews by assuring the required documentation is prepared, letters of invitation have been sent, and that updates have been completed prior to the review.
